Abstract

In handling scholarship data for outstanding students, the Labuhanbatu Regency government in general still uses manual recording, namely by using a ledger and there is no computerization in determining the receipt of scholarships for outstanding students, so there are many mistakes in determining it.

The problem faced by the many recipients of scholarships for outstanding students who are not appropriate so that those who deserve to receive do not receive and those who do not deserve to receive scholarships. This problem occurs because of the difficulty in implementing the selection of scholarship recipients due to the large number of applicants and the number of the same criteria in receiving scholarships. So that mistakes often occur To apply for a scholarship at the People's Welfare Office in the Labuhanbatu Regency government, students must fill out a form containing data from the student, such as Grade Point Average (GPA), Parents' income, Number of Siblings, Number of Dependent Parents. The ranking process in receiving scholarships uses the Entropy Method in giving weighting to the criteria objectively and the ARAS Method, which is a suitable method in determining the calculation of weights based on predetermined criteria and ranking from a set of alternative data that kick each other. So that it can reduce the errors that have been faced so far.
